[PHP] Zeichensatz Sonderzeichen

Dieses Thema im Forum "Webentwicklung" wurde erstellt von Phame, 29. Januar 2012 .

Status des Themas:
Es sind keine weiteren Antworten möglich.
  1. 29. Januar 2012
    Zeichensatz Sonderzeichen

    Hallo,

    ich hab ein seltsames Problem,

    wenn ich in PHP den Zeichensatz auf einer Seite mit spanischen und deutschen Sonderzeichen auf UTF-8 Stelle werden die Spanischen richtig dargestellt, aber deutsche wie "ß" nicht mehr.

    Sobald ich auf UTF-7 stelle ist es genau umgekehrt.

    Wie kann ich das Problem lösen?


    Mfg
     
  2. 29. Januar 2012
    AW: Zeichensatz Sonderzeichen

    verwende UTF-8 auch bei speichern deiner daten.

    im übrigen ist UTF-7 keine wirkliche zeichencodierung, sondern eher ein unicode "workaround" für 7-bit umgebungen, welchen du mit ziemlicher sicherheit nicht wirklich auf deiner webseite verwendest ...
     
  3. 29. Januar 2012
    AW: Zeichensatz Sonderzeichen

    Kommen die Daten aus der Datenbank?
    Falls ja dann solltest du mit der ersten Query den Zeichensatz bestimmen.

    Das hatte ich zumindest mal als Problem gehabt.
     
  4. 29. Januar 2012
    AW: Zeichensatz Sonderzeichen

    Hat glaub ich mit dem auslesen aus der DB nichts zu tun, Zeichen wie "r+?@+¡+ª33" werden Problemlos dargestellt nur beim "ßüäö.." macht es Probleme.

    Kann das auch etwas mit AJAX zu tun haben?

    ok, anscheinend brauch ich nur utf8_decode();
     
  5. Video Script

    Videos zum Themenbereich

    * gefundene Videos auf YouTube, anhand der Überschrift.